Summary
An Israeli airstrike in southern Lebanon has reportedly killed at least 10 firefighters and injured others as they were preparing for a rescue mission. The attack occurred in the town of Baraachit, highlighting the ongoing violence and humanitarian crisis resulting from the escalating conflict between Israel and militant groups in the region.
This incident is part of a broader pattern of violence that has intensified since the onset of the Israel-Hamas war a year ago. The Lebanese Health Ministry indicated that the airstrike may lead to an increased death toll, as more individuals were trapped under the rubble. The strike coincided with a barrage of rockets fired by Palestinian militants from Gaza into Israel, marking the anniversary of the October 7 attack that initiated the ongoing conflict. As Israel continues its military operations, including airstrikes in Lebanon and Gaza, the humanitarian situation remains dire, with significant civilian casualties and widespread displacement reported across both regions.
Context of the Airstrike
-
Ongoing Conflict: The airstrike on firefighters underscores the complex and violent dynamics of the conflict involving Israel, Hezbollah, and Hamas. Since the outbreak of hostilities, both sides have engaged in retaliatory strikes, leading to numerous civilian casualties and destruction.
-
Humanitarian Impact: The Lebanese government estimates that around 1.2 million people have been displaced due to the conflict, with many facing dire living conditions. The airstrike’s targeting of first responders raises concerns about the safety of civilians and emergency personnel amid military operations.
